Typical Issues with Patio Doors
Before diving into the repair process, it's important to identify the typical concerns that can occur with patio doors. Here are some of the most frequent issues property owners face:

Difficulty in sliding Patio Door Installation or Opening
Causes: Misalignment, worn-out rollers, or particles in the track.Signs: The door might be tough to move, or it might not open or close efficiently.
Dripping or Drafty Doors
Causes: Damaged weatherstripping, gaps around the frame, or a jeopardized seal.Symptoms: Cold drafts, water seepage, or increased energy bills.
Broken Locks or Handles
Causes: Wear and tear, improper setup, or damage from force.Symptoms: The lock might not engage correctly, or the manage may be loose or broken.
Split or Damaged Glass
Causes: Impact from items, severe temperature level changes, or old age.Symptoms: Visible fractures, chips, or shattered glass.
Noisy Operation

Inspect the Track:
Clean the track using a vacuum or a brush to eliminate any debris.Look for any blockages or damage to the track.
Inspect the Rollers:
Remove the door from the track and inspect the rollers for wear and tear.Replace any damaged or damaged rollers with new ones.
Realign the Door:
Adjust the rollers or the door frame to make sure the door is properly aligned.Utilize a level to check for any misalignment and make required changes.2. Leaking or Drafty Doors
Replace Weatherstripping:
Remove the old weatherstripping and tidy the location.Install brand-new weatherstripping, guaranteeing it fits comfortably around the door.
Seal Gaps:
Use caulk or weatherproofing tape to seal any spaces around the door frame.Ensure the seal is continuous and devoid of gaps.3. Broken Locks or Handles
Check the Lock Mechanism:
Check for any noticeable damage or wear.Lubricate the lock system with a silicone-based lube.
Replace the Lock:
If the lock is damaged beyond repair, remove it and install a new one.Guarantee the new lock is compatible with the existing hardware.
Protect the Handle:
Tighten any loose screws or bolts.If the manage is damaged, replace it with a brand-new one.4. Cracked or Damaged Glass
Assess the Damage:
Determine if the glass can be repaired or if it requires to be replaced.For minor fractures, think about using a glass repair kit.
Replace the Glass:
Remove the damaged glass and clean the frame.Install a brand-new piece of glass, guaranteeing it is properly secured.5. Noisy Operation
Lube the Hardware:
Apply a silicone-based lubricant to the rollers and hinges.Ensure all moving parts are well-lubricated.
Tighten Up Loose Hardware:
Check all screws and bolts and tighten up any that are loose.Replace any broken hardware as needed.

Q: How typically should I clean my patio door track?
A: It's an excellent concept to clean the track a minimum of once a year, or more often if you live in a location with a lot of dust or particles.
Q: Can I replace the glass in my patio door myself?
A: While it is possible to replace the glass yourself, it can be a complex job and may require unique tools. If you're not comfortable with the procedure, it's best to consult an expert.
Q: What type of weatherstripping should I use for my Sliding Patio Door Repairs door?
A: There are several types of weatherstripping readily available, consisting of foam, rubber, and vinyl. Choose a type that works with your door and provides a good seal.
Q: How can I prevent my Patio Door Spring Repair door from ending up being drafty?
A: Regular upkeep, such as cleaning up the track, lubing the hardware, and changing weatherstripping, can assist prevent drafts. Furthermore, guarantee the door is properly lined up and sealed.
Q: What should I do if my patio door lock is jammed?
A: Try lubricating the lock with a silicone-based lubricant. If that doesn't work, you may require to dismantle the lock to get rid of any obstructions. If the lock is harmed, it may require to be replaced.
